Just thought I'd share how dave has set my bike up for me.
Dave has been in nz running clinics and I was chuffed when he used my bike to show basic suspension setup during his appearance at a club gathering.
My bike was stock settings as per manual at the front --- fourth line showing for preload and 1 turn from hard rebound so the punch and reference marks match.
When he bounced the front, all gathered could see the return action was real slow. After a couple of tries, he set the rebound at plus half turn softer. Now the action was even down and up and resettling just once. No oscillation.

At the back, the true lack of balance showed when he bounced the shock -- it went bounced up and down a few times. My preload setting was at the stock setting, seven clicks from full soft. But the previous rider had slacked off the rebound a fair bit I realize now. ( don't know how much as I assumed it was stock because I saw that the punch marks aligned when I got the bike.)

Out with the screwdriver and Dave finally settled on what I found to be 1-1/2 turns out from maximum hard on the shock rebound screw. Setting as per manual is 3/4 turn out from maximum hard.

On bouncing the bike from the middle to check if the front and back was working in unison, he decided the rear preload at seven was too high and softened it to four clicks from softest setting.

As time was short, he did not measure sag with me on board, but I am about 65kg geared up and he reckoned it would be all good.

Just those simple tweaks has transformed the bike for me. It feels tauter and more stable whether on the straight or in the turns, particularly smoothening out the long sweepers. My grip on the bars has relaxed considerably as the bike is so much easier to control and my wrists don't feel the strain as much in comparison to the before settings.

It also felt like the transmission was slicker with gears snicking into place up and down smoothly. Felt like the engine had a bit more punch to it but Dave explained that as "being able to get on the power a bit more quickly as the bike was more stable!"

I ain't no expert and as you rightly point out, every rider is different, weight wise and riding style wise. But what I gather the key point is get the front and rear suspension working together. That's the first step. Second point I took from the demo is that the stock settings for the rebound front and back are too hard and or do not match the springs to work together as one.

Dave encouraged us to work to get this set right. But when the limits of the stock suspension have been found and the ideal can't be found for a particular rider, then look to spring rates and revalving.

To try and answer your question re your weight, with stock suspension, My wife often pillions and I asked Dave what changes be needed from solo riding. He said jack up the rear preload (he said to the max, I tried it with just two lines showing) and plus half turn harder for the rebound. Plus 2 or more psi in rear tyre and front tyre. No changes to front preload and rebound.

I tried his recommendations and it worked as well as when riding solo. I guess in a roundabout way, I am saying there is enough adjustment in the stock suspension for your weight. I suggest you try the fork setup as I posted earlier as well as the rebound setting for shock, but set shock preload five clicks in from full soft.

To explain why he set the shock preload from seven clicks to four: when he found an imbalance in the action between front and rear, he immediately went to the back of the bike and tried lift it. It lifted all right. There was no give at the top of the shock stroke. He said a dead space was absent. Once he dialed the preload softer, all could see there was "give" before the shock stroke topped out. That, I think is static sag.

Been having a play about with the suspension this morning. Any thoughts on what the front sag should be? On stock setting around 50mm with preload showing just one ring now 40mm. Some websites stating it should be 25 - 30mm while others 45 - 50mm. Would take it for test ride but live near two salt mines and roads are like salt city at the moment.


Ohlins manual says front 30-40 with rider on board, rear 25-35 mm rider sag. It also says front and rear action must match for safety and stability. Dave has a simple on road test. Use only compression/engine braking going into a corner to see if the front dives. It it does than up the preload as required.
